Description
A comforting and nourishing wrap filled with tuna, cheese, and fresh veggies, perfect for busy weeknights.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 can canned tuna
- 1/2 cup Greek yogurt
- 4 whole wheat tortillas
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up diced celery
- 1/4 cup diced red onion
- 2 cups spinach or mixed greens
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Prepare the filling: In a medium bowl, combine the canned tuna, Greek yogurt, diced celery, and red onion. Mix well until everything is evenly coated.
- Add spices: Sprinkle in garlic powder, pepper, and any other seasonings you love.
- Assemble the wrap: Lay out the whole wheat tortillas and layer a generous amount of the tuna mixture down the center. Add a handful of spinach and top with shredded cheese.
- Wrap it up: Fold in the sides of the tortilla and roll it up tightly from the bottom.
- Cook the wrap: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at. Place the wraps seam side down in the skillet and cook for 2-3 minutes until golden brown.
Notes
Try adding sliced avocado for creaminess or swapping in smoked tuna for a different flavor twist.
